Steyne Park


Overview
Located in Sydney’s Eastern Suburbs, Steyne Park in Double Bay is an unfenced off-leash area at its northern end. The park provides a bright, waterside community setting next to the harbour.
Steyne Park is known for its foreshore lawn space, boat ramp for non-motorised watercraft, gazebo, benches, playground, and nearby access to the water via the Double Bay Sailing Club. There is street parking around the park.
Owners should know that dogs must be on leash except in the specific off-leash area between the seawall and pedestrian path. Off-leash is permitted at all times in that section except when sailing rigging is underway during organised events.
The reserve is a short stroll from Double Bay Ferry Wharf, local cafés, shops, and highlights of the harbour, making it ideal for combining dog-walks with errands or relaxed outings.
Steyne Park is best suited to social, moderate-energy dogs that are comfortable off leash in defined zones and respond well to recall.
Steyne Park is managed by Woollahra Council.
